Property claim by sister

I have bought a property with co owner as my father. I have done all the investment and paying the EMI. Is it possible that my sister can claim the property share which belongs to my father? Or is it possible that my father gives my sister the share owned by him?

Sister has no right on your property but she would lay claim on her father's property.

 

However you should understand that if your father invested from his self-acquired property then no one can claim unless there is no "partition". Also when there would be a partition, your father's property shall be divided into equal parts for all share holders like your mother, you, your sister and father. So, the calculation would be as below:

 

Suppose the value of the property is Rs.100, and S no. of share holders, then:

 

Your share = Rs.50 (your seperate share) + Rs. (50 / S) (share from father's property)

Your father's share = Rs. (50 / S) (after partition)

Your Sister's share = Rs. (50 / S) (after partition)

Your Mother's share = Rs. (50 / S) (after partition) .............. and so on!
